alanasgari86 Posted January 24, 2007 Posted January 24, 2007 (edited) I am new to writing batch files and everything to do with integrating silent installs...I tired WPI but i didnt like to too much so i started attempting batch files to try and assist with creating an unattended installation.The following is what I have been using:ECHO.ECHO Installing Microsoft Office11 ProfessionalECHO (Please wait until setup.exe has finished running before continuing)start /wait "Microsoft Office 2003" "%PROGRAMFILES%\Source Installation Files\Office11\SETUP.EXE" TRANSFORMS="%PROGRAMFILES%\Source Installation Files\Office11\Office11.MST"The is says it cannot find pro11.msi...can someone please tell me what im doing wrong? ElGranados Posted January 24, 2007 Posted January 24, 2007 (edited) Try this:start /wait "%programfiles%\Source Installation Files\Office11\setup.exe" TRANSFORMS="Office11.MST" /qbFirst, you didn't give him a silent parameter (e.g. /qb or /qn) and second, if your *.mst is in the same folder as the setup.exe, you can leave out the path.hf Edited January 24, 2007 by ElGranados
Shark007 Posted January 24, 2007 Posted January 24, 2007 Instead of pointing to setup.exe, try pointing to pro11.msishark
